MENDES, Joana Calado. A new international role for Portugal? The Portuguese participation in the UNSC. Relações Internacionais [online]. 2015, n.47, pp.85-100. ISSN 1645-9199.

The increase number of institutions in the international system is due to a general recognition of its ability to solve the most pressing issues in International Relations. In this sense, the participation in the Security Council proves to be a unique opportunity for smaller states, traditionally without significance on multilateral issues, to develop international practices and to defend and promote their national interests. This article uses the institutional theory to help understand how the participation in United Nations works as a condition and as an instrument of Portuguese foreign policy, allowing the assignment of a new international role for Portugal as helpful fixer, and its evolution to a middle power in the international system.

Palabras clave : Portugal; Security Council; United Nations; helpful fixer.
